The term Margin Call describes the alert sent by a broker to notify a trader that the capital in their account has fallen below the minimum amount needed to keep a position open; i.e. the total capital a trader has deposited plus or minus any profits or losses, drops below his margin requirement

Say you select a stock with an ask price of $25 and you open a CFD to the value of 100 shares. If buying shares the traditional way, the cost would be $2,500. There might also be commission or trading costs. However, a CFD broker will often require just a 5% margin History Invention. Margin Requirement. The margin requirement in CFD trading is the amount of capital actually required from the trader to open a position. For example, if the leverage is 1:30 and you want to trade in a value of $10,000, the required margin will be equal to $333 Trading on margin CFDs typically provides higher leverage than traditional trading. Standard leverage in the CFD market can be as low as a 2% margin requirement and as high as a 20% margin

Forex brokers use margin levels to determine whether you can open additional positions. Different brokers set different Margin Level limits, but most brokers set this limit at 100%.. This means that when your Equity is equal or less than your Used Margin, you will NOT be able to open any new positions

Initial margin is the margin that you must furnish in order to transact in a CFD and is calculated as a percentage of the full contract value.
